SB 934

Pregnancy Support and Wellness Services

2025 Regular Session

Florida bill to establish pregnancy support and wellness services died in committee after being indefinitely postponed in May 2025.

Bill Summary · SB 934

Legislative bill overview

SB 934 would establish or expand pregnancy support and wellness services in Florida, likely including prenatal care, maternal health resources, or pregnancy-related assistance programs. The bill was referred to health policy and fiscal committees, indicating it involved both programmatic and budgetary considerations before ultimately failing to advance.

Why is this important

Pregnancy-related healthcare and support services directly affect maternal and infant health outcomes, which have significant public health implications. The bill's fiscal routing suggests it would have involved state spending, making it relevant to both healthcare policy and budget allocation debates.

Potential points of contention

  • Scope and cost of services: Disagreement over which pregnancy support services should be state-funded and the associated budgetary impact
  • Provider eligibility and requirements: Questions about which healthcare providers could deliver these services and any regulatory standards
  • Relationship to abortion policy: Potential concerns about how pregnancy support services relate to broader abortion restrictions or access debates in Florida's current political environment
